If you are talking about WM6 devices just go to Start->Programs and then
look for "Internet Sharing." If you find "Internet Sharing" then see if it
has an option for "Bluetooth PAN."
And don't forget, even if you have the option for "Bluetooth PAN" it might
not work without adding something like "Phone as Modem" to your cellphone
plan.
BTW I've used both BT PAN and BT DUN and they both have their advantages and
disadvantages.
